I AL/ sunGEV11TY' a A11',"' P 14 February 9, 2016 Subject: Structural Certification for Installation of Solar Panels ,Job #: 2317397 Client: Bodet Address: 46 Holly Ridge Rd, North Andover, MA 01845 To Whom It May Concern, A field observation and design check of the subject property was conducted to determine the suitability of the existing roof structure to support the installation of solar panels. From the field observation of the property, the existing roof structure was observed as follows: The existing roof structure consists of composition shingles over plywood sheathing that is supported by 2x8 roof rafters spaced at 16" on center. "The rafters are sloped at approximately 40 degrees and have a maximum projected horizontal span of 13'-4" at Array 1 and 12'-3" at Array 2 between load bearing walls. Utilizing the information determined from the field observation, the attached structural calculations have been prepared for the subject property in accordance with the following design criteria: Applicable Codes: 2009 IBC, ASCE 7-05 and 2005 NDS Basic Wind Speed = 100 mph Exposure Category = B Ground Snow Load = 50 psf As a result of the completed field observation and design check, I certify that the capacity of the existing roof structure that directly Supports the additional loading due to the installation of solar panel Supports arid modules has been reviewed and determined to meet or exceed the requirements ofthe 2009 International Building Code. Traditionally,solar modules are grounded by attaching . lugs,bolts or clips to the module frame,then connecting prepare Rail Connections these to a copper conductor that runs throughout the _ array This process adds time and cost to the installation. Insert splice into first rail,then secure with Grounding Strap and and often results in improper grounding,creating self-drilling screw, significant long-term safety risks. _ •Slide second rail over splice,then secure with apposite end of The IronRidge Integrated Grounding System solves these Grounding Strap and self-drilling screw. challenges by bonding modules directly to the mounting rails_This approach eliminates separate module Mount&Ground Rails grounding hardware,and it creates many parallel grounding paths throughout the array,providing Attach rails to L-Feet and level rails. greater safety for system owners. ANSI C12.20 is currently recognized as the industry standard for electrical socket meters in both utility and PV monitoring applications.These tests cover both meter accuracy as well as several safety standards including electrical and environmental safety,as well as resistance to various types of mechanical shock.As electrical socket meters are generally installed and maintained by trained and certified professionals,rather than consumers,they do not fit the typical criteria for additional types of UL or IEC certification.
